Does anyone know what this is?
I have been all across the internet looking to identify these tablets but cant find anything except a vague reference from someone saying they had got one matching the discription in thailand and it helped them sleep. The thread was from 2008 so not really recent. I feel like i have looked everywhere and still cant find a thing.